Adenocarcinoma within a sigmoid diverticular segment

Discussion:

On the basis of the imaging findings of numerous diverticula in the region of the sigmoid colon abnormality, this was considered to be a diverticular stricture. The other most predictive feature of malignancy, shouldered edges, was not convincingly seen. This case highlights the overlap in findings between diverticular and malignant strictures of the sigmoid colon, with the pathology analysis here showing that this was in fact a malignant stricture.
